No, you do not necessarily need certification to be a relationship coach. Unlike professions such as therapy or counseling, which often have specific licensing or certification requirements, relationship coaching is currently an unregulated field in many jurisdictions. Yes, a life coach can help with relationships, including romantic relationships, family dynamics, friendships, and professional relationships. Life coaches can provide support, guidance, and strategies to help individuals improve their relationships, resolve conflicts, set boundaries, and communicate effectively.
